import custom dashboard¶
This page introduces how to import customized dashboards through CRD and UI interface.
Import Dashboard via CRD¶
-
Log in to the DCE 5.0 platform, enter
Container Management
from the left navigation bar, and select the target cluster in the cluster list. -
Select
Custom Resources
on the left navigation bar, findgrafanadashboards.integreatly.org
file in the list, and enter the details. -
Click
Create with YAML
and use the following template, replacing the dashboard JSON in theJson
field.namespace
: Fill in the target namespace;name
: fill in the name of the dashboard.
apiVersion: integrally.org/v1alpha1 kind: Grafana Dashboard metadata: labels: app: insight-grafana-operator operator.insight.io/managed-by: insight name: sample-dashboard namespace: insight-system spec: json: > { "id": null, "title": "Simple Dashboard", "tags": [], "style": "dark", "timezone": "browser", "editable": true, "hideControls": false, "graphTooltip": 1, "panels": [], "time": { "from": "now-6h", "to": "now" }, "timepicker": { "time_options": [], "refresh_intervals": [] }, "templating": { "list": [] }, "annotations": { "list": [] }, "refresh": "5s", "schemaVersion": 17, "version": 0, "links": [] }
-
After clicking
Confirm
, wait for a while to view the newly imported dashboard inDashboard
.
Import Dashboard via UI¶
This section explains how to access native Grafana to build custom dashboards.
-
Click
Dashboards
>Import
on the left navigation bar. -
You can choose to import in the following ways:
- Upload the dashboard JSON file
- Paste the Grafana.com dashboard URL
- Paste the dashboard JSON into the text area
-
After clicking
Load
, fill in the following parameters:- name: set the name of the dashboard
- Floder: select the target path for dashboard storage
- Prometheus: select data source
-
Click
Import
to import the dashboard successfully.
